Web Scraping, Data Extraction and Automation 2

Web Data Extractor & Scraper Tool

Web Scraping, Data Extraction and Automation

The history of the web scraping dates again practically to the time when the Internet was born. This lets you undergo the Extract Wizard once more, to extract additional information and add it as a new column in the identical desk. Customize column headers and choose whether or not to extract URLs.

Scrap The Web Scraping: The Guide To Automating Web Data Extraction

, and Outtask was bought by travel expense company Concur.In 2012, a startup known as 3Taps scraped classified housing advertisements a guide to scraping contact information for sales leads from Craigslist. Craigslist sent 3Taps a cease-and-desist letter and blocked their IP addresses and later sued, in Craigslist v. 3Taps.

Kofax’s Intelligent Automation software program platform and solutions digitally remodel doc intensive workflows. facebook and cambridge analytica may maintain me knowledgeable with emails about services and products.
You will also learn how to use the REST API client, Postman, to test an API before writing your code. REST APIs normally generate output in JSON or XML format as a result of most of programming languages can handle these codecs simply. In reality, JSON is very similar to data varieties in programming languages; for example, it is extremely similar to Python dictionaries. Obfuscation using CSS sprites to display such information as cellphone numbers or e-mail addresses, at the price of accessibility to screen reader users.
The scraping wizard may be opened from the Design tab, by clicking the Data Scraping button. It is beneficial to run your internet automations on Internet Explorer eleven and above, Mozilla Firefox 50 or above, or the most recent model of Google Chrome. Robotics and Automation News was established in May, 2015, and is now one of the most extensively-learn web sites in its category. The article is a fundamental introduction to net scraping and net scraping with Python.
These platforms create and monitor a large number of “bots” for specific verticals with no “man within the loop” , and no work associated to a particular goal website. The preparation involves establishing the information base for the complete vertical and then the platform creates the bots routinely. The platform’s robustness is measured by the standard of the knowledge it retrieves and its scalability . This scalability is generally used to focus on the Long Tail of web sites that frequent aggregators discover sophisticated or too labor-intensive to reap content material from. Static and dynamic internet pages can be retrieved by posting HTTP requests to the distant net server using socket programming.
Seamlessly integrate enriched and cleansed information immediately into your business purposes with powerful APIs. This list consists of industrial as well as open-source instruments with well-liked features and newest obtain link. Once it’s carried out, you’ll be able to determine if the extracted data is what you need. Step four.Once it’s completed, you’ll have the ability to resolve if the extracted info is what you want.
We provide ready to use extractors that are devoted to the worlds greatest online web sites. You will require more than primary coding expertise to use this device because it has a high studying curve.
Once you’ve some content into them, you can let them rest and make passive revenue for you. Contact me for some actual life case research of area of interest web sites that I actually have developed.
Get your group access to four,000+ top Udemy courses anytime, anywhere. Websites can declare if crawling is allowed or not in the robots.txt file and allow partial entry, limit the crawl price, specify the optimum time to crawl and extra.
I supply net scraping, knowledge mining and information extraction services for lead generation, business course of automation, market analysis and competitor analysis. Data is extracted, filtered and packaged in various codecs together with CSV, JSON and XML.
In this course, you will begin by learning how to extract information utilizing a quite simple currency fee conversion API that does not require any authentication but it’s going to train you the fundamentals of utilizing REST APIs. After that, you’ll research extra superior video tutorials on subtle APIs such as Yelp and Google Places.
Read any HTML or different Document Object Model factor from a desk of costs, to a complete directory and extract all the data discovered. WinAutomation can store the extracted data as Variables, or sustain with any data structure such as maintain in Excel, or any database. Data Miner’s community is made up of recruiters, sales representatives and small enterprise homeowners. Whether you goal is to do lead generation or value comparability, Data Miner might help you streamline the method.
Web scraping, net harvesting, or web data extraction is knowledge scraping used for extracting knowledge from websites. Web scraping software program might access the World Wide Web directly using the Hypertext Transfer Protocol, or through a web browser. While internet scraping can be done manually by a software person, the time period sometimes refers to automated processes implemented utilizing a bot or internet crawler. It is a form of copying, by which specific knowledge is gathered and copied from the online, typically right into a central local database or spreadsheet, for later retrieval or evaluation.
WinAutomation can mechanically crawl and extract information from multiple pages. Just point to the link that acts as pager and select ‘Element as pager’ and you are good to go.
Actions are useful for simulating real-world human interplay with the page. They are carried out by scraper upon visiting a Web page helping you to be nearer to desired knowledge. We offer Dataflow equipment Proxies service to get around content material download restrictions from particular web sites or ship requests by way of proxies to acquire country-particular variations of goal web sites.


Studio mechanically detects when you indicated a desk cell, and asks you if you wish to extract the whole desk. If you click on Yes, the Extract Wizard shows a preview of the selected desk data. Select the first and final fields within the internet web page, document or utility that you just want to extract data from, so that Studio can deduce the pattern of the knowledge. Please contemplate supporting us by becoming a paying subscriber, or by way of advertising and sponsorships, or by purchasing products and services through our shop – or a combination of all of the above.
The world’s hottest open-supply Node.js library for web crawling and scraping. Market analysis Generate insights into your market from publicly available knowledge on the internet. Apify is a software platform that permits forward-considering corporations to leverage the full potential of the net—the most important supply of information ever created by humankind.

Personal Tools

For instance, JSON is usually used as a transport storage mechanism between the shopper and the net server. Lastly, all of the scraped info is saved in a DataTable variable, you could later use to populate a database, a .csv file or an Excel spreadsheet. Additionally, the Extract Structured Data exercise also comes with an routinely generated XML string that signifies the data to be extracted. Data scraping at all times generates a container with a selector for the top-degree window and an Extract Structured Data exercise with a partial selector, thus guaranteeing a correct identification of the app to be scraped. Preview the information, edit the variety of most outcomes to be extracted and alter the order of the columns.
On April 30, 2020, French Data Protection Authority released new pointers on web scraping. The CNIL tips made it clear that publicly available knowledge remains to be private information and cannot be repurposed without the information of the particular CBT Email Extractor person to whom that information belongs. By embedding a full-fledged net browser, such because the Internet Explorer or the Mozilla browser control, packages can retrieve the dynamic content generated by shopper-facet scripts.

Use considered one of 50,000 publicly out there extraction queries to extract information with one click on. Exceptional service and prompt communication will certainly contact you once more. We collect unstructured information from the job portal and deliver it in a structured format you could feed your hungry HR, Recruitment group. Having a supply of high quality knowledge for job listings, candidate sourcing, wage scale, market insight leads to higher hiring decisions. With Competitive Data Scraping, retail companies turn out to be extra dynamic and intelligent.
Web Scraping, Data Extraction and Automation
And Besides, Chrome is provided with tools for saving HTML as PDF and generating screenshots from an online page. JavaScript Frameworks are used broadly in most trendy internet purposes. You ought to most like need to render JavaSctipt + HTML to static HTML before scraping a webpage content material, put it aside as PDF, or seize a screenshot. Automate is an intuitive IT automation platform designed to help companies of any measurement enhance efficiency and maximize ROI all through the organization.
You can also monitor mentions of your model on social media by regularly looking your model’s name, organising alerts or utilizing third-celebration social media monitoring software program program. Many social media sites may also offer you analytics about how your posts carry out. We use internally save scraped data into S3 appropriate storage, supplying you with high availability and scalability. Store from a couple of data to some hundred million, with the same low latency and high reliability. Render JavaScript web pages, scrape internet/ SERP data, create PDF, and capture screenshots right from your application.
These browser controls also parse net pages into a DOM tree, primarily based on which programs can retrieve elements of the pages. Languages similar to Xpath can be utilized to parse the ensuing DOM tree.
Fully-managed, enterprise-grade internet crawling resolution to effortlessly turn hundreds of thousands of website pages into useful information. Of course, it is not sufficient in many instances to scrape internet pages however to carry out tasks with them. Just specify the target nation from a hundred+ supported world areas to ship your net/ SERPs scraping API requests. We supply Service for rendering dynamic JavaScript driven net pages to static HTML in our cloud. We visit web pages on your behalf, render Javascript-pushed pages with headless Chrome in the cloud, return static HTML, and capture screenshots or save as PDF.
  • One of its primary benefits is that it’s built on prime of a Twisted asynchronous networking framework.
  • We provide you with personalized internet scraping instruments and information extraction solutions to free you from laborious duties of information collection for your analysis and analysis.
  • By leveraging the assorted automation instruments, we simplify the net scraping course of and assist you to get significant insights on your businesses.
  • Scrapy is an open supply net scraping framework in Python used to build web scrapers.
  • It provides you all of the tools you need to efficiently extract data from web sites, process them, and store them in your most well-liked construction and format.

Web Scrape is likely one of the main Web Scraping, Robotic Process Automation service suppliers across the globe at present, which presents a number of advantages to all of the customers. Getting contact knowledge is not hard – getting extremely focused contacts is!
Web Scrape covers essentially the most robust crawling infrastructure that ensures the smooth delivery of data daily. We be sure that the highest level of customer support is given to each and every buyer, each single day. It’s our job to know the specific needs of our prospects and find the most effective answer for the customer’s needs and necessities. Thousands of the world’s massive corporations depend upon Web Scrape every day to remodel hundreds of thousands of net pages into actionable data.
To discuss your information extraction and transformation requirements, join with me right here. Web scraping is the process of automating data extraction from websites on a big scale. With each area of work in the world becoming dependent on information, web scraping or internet crawling methods are being more and more used to collect knowledge from the internet and acquire insights for private or business use. Web scraping tools and software let you download knowledge in a structured CSV, Excel, or XML format and save time spent in manually copy-pasting this data. In this submit, we check out some of the best free and paid internet scraping tools and software program.
While we can not present authorized expertise, we would encourage you to read a number of of the next literature and all the time confirm the phrases of service of the website online you’re scraping. The worth for scraping a website varies, with some on-line freelancers providing terribly low prices corresponding to $10/website.
WinAutomation comes with an in depth range of out-of-the-field options for all your automation and process development needs, enabling you to unlock your potential. So if you should net scrape a listing of things (name, handle, e-mail, value and so forth.) from an internet page, you only want to pick the first few and WinAutomation will acknowledge the whole listing. Often net pages show data corresponding to product listings in a number of pages.
Southwest Airlines charged that the display screen-scraping is Illegal since it is an instance of “Computer Fraud and Abuse” and has led to “Damage and Loss” and “Unauthorized Access” of Southwest’s web site. It additionally constitutes “Interference with Business Relations”, “Trespass”, and “Harmful Access by Computer”. They additionally claimed that display screen-scraping constitutes what’s legally known as “Misappropriation and Unjust Enrichment”, in addition to being a breach of the website’s user settlement. Although the circumstances had been never resolved within the Supreme Court of the United States, FareChase was finally shuttered by father or mother firm Yahoo!

Specialized information storages to handle internet scraping jobs, save their outcomes and export them to formats like CSV, Excel or JSON. A computing platform that makes it straightforward to develop, run and share serverless cloud applications. We adopt a particular approach for choosing content material we provide; we mainly focus on skills which might be incessantly requested by clients and jobs while there are solely few movies that cowl them. We also try to construct video sequence to cowl not only the fundamentals, but in addition the advanced areas. Some prior programming experience in Python (e.g. Data Structures and File Handling) will help.
In this case, we have to extract the pictures along with the product names and prices into columns. BotScraper is a leading net scraping firm in the space providing efficient and setting pleasant web scraping, internet crawling and data extraction firms. Through the primary knowledge collection strategies described above, yow will discover out about who your purchasers are, what they’re excited about and what they need from you as a company. You can look by way of your follower itemizing to see who follows you and what traits they’ve in widespread to strengthen your understanding of who your target audience should be.

If you discover a crawler not scraping a specific subject you want, drop in an e mail and ScrapeHero Cloud group will get again to you with a custom plan. In three steps you can set up a crawler – Open your browser, Create an account in ScrapeHero Cloud and select the crawler that you just wish to run. When David isn’t serving to clients with scraping he does fun science experiments along with his niece. Automatically click on to the subsequent web page and scrape using Auto Pagination.
Locating bots with a honeypot or other technique to determine the IP addresses of automated crawlers. Disabling any web service API that the web site’s system may expose. Southwest Airlines has additionally challenged screen-scraping practices, and has involved each FareChase and another agency, Outtask, in a legal declare.
ScrapeHero Cloud crawlers allow you to to scrape data at high speeds and supports data export in JSON, CSV and Excel codecs. To receive up to date information, there may be the option to schedule crawlers and deliver data on to your Dropbox.

Scraping real-time costs of products from tons of of internet sites helps e-commerce companies formulate pricing strategies, modify to price variations & analyze customer opinions. Disparate of the complexity of the requirement, our customized net crawlers are flexible enough to deliver tailored data solutions by tackling the nuances of net scraping. We provide absolutely managed, enterprise-ready knowledge as a service – From collecting and structuring to cleaning, normalizing and maintaining the data quality. Bypass CAPTCHA issues rotating proxies to extract real-time data with ease. Get excessive-quality information validated towards pre-built business rules with rigorous data high quality.
Click to extract textual content, photographs, attributes with a degree-and-click web scraper interface. A common HTTP proxy to cover the origin of your web scrapers, using each 100 common email spam trigger words and phrases to avoid datacenter and residential IP addresses. Product improvement Build new products and services by aggregating knowledge from the web and automating workflows.
Author Bio

About the Author: Maren is a blogger at jessiesbranch, urbanvapeandcbd and hempstaff.







Telephone:+972 547655329

Address: 8200 Menaul Blvd NE, # RAlbuquerque, New Mexico

Published Articles:

Guest post

As Featured in


Step By Step Guide To Web Scraping Javascript Content Using Puppeteer And Node Js

A simple but highly effective approach to extract information from web pages may be primarily based on the UNIX grep command or common expression-matching facilities of programming languages . Newer forms of internet scraping contain listening to knowledge feeds from internet servers.
is a Node library which provides a powerful but simple API that allows you to control Google’s headless Chrome browser. A headless browser means you’ve a browser that may send and receive requests but has no GUI.
Another similar net scraping provider, ProWebScraper is quite near Connotate. Ideal for giant scale information intelligence initiatives handling, massive database and higher capability necessities. Ideal for Small and Medium scale projects where steady data is requried. Ideal for Small and Medium scale projects the place steady dynamic knowledge is required.

The court held that the cease-and-desist letter and IP blocking was sufficient for Craigslist to properly declare that 3Taps had violated the Computer Fraud and Abuse Act. There are efforts utilizing machine learning and computer imaginative and prescient that try and identify and extract information from web pages by deciphering pages visually as a human being may. There are several corporations which have developed vertical particular harvesting platforms.
Bulkscraping is a web scraping and information-collection firm, offering data extraction, display scraping and b2b lead technology companies. We offer you personalized web scraping tools and knowledge extraction solutions to free you from laborious duties of information assortment on your research and analysis.

It works in the background, performing actions as instructed by an API. You can simulate the user experience, typing the place they sort and clicking where they click on. is a Node.js library which is so much like Scrapy positioning itself as a universal internet scraping library in JavaScript, with support for Puppeteer, Cheerio and extra. ScrapeHero Cloud crawlers can be custom-made based mostly on customer needs as properly.
Web Scraping, Data Extraction and Automation

Once you find the information related to your project on the net page, you can obtain it to get priceless insights. To do this, Python supplies one other library called BeautifulSoup, which helps you fetch particular content material from a webpage, delete HTML tags, and save the information. Below are some reasons why Python is essentially the most appropriate programming language for web scraping. Python can work on many alternative platforms and has a easy syntax much like the English language, subsequently, it’s simple to code. In this text, we’ll allow you to get some know-how about net scraping and utilizing Python to scrape an internet site.

We hope it is formative and may provide some essential data to you. Besides, there’s another software framework in Python called Scrapy, which you need to use to carry out net scraping. Data scraped from social media offers you a fantastic alternative to know people or groups and establish market developments.

Data Miner uses HTTPS encryption to guard your privacy and safety. Data Miner behaves as when you have been clicking on the page your self in your own browser. Captain Data has helped scale our operations by building an automated sales machine. The platform is spectacular and extremely modular, which allow us to quickly experiment and scale workflows.
Web Scraping, Data Extraction and Automation